Vitu provides innovative, cutting-edge services to the motor vehicle industry.

Our namesake solution manages titling and registration transactions in all 50 states and across multiple locations — all on one platform.

With the mission of expanding and automating Vehicle-to-Government (V2Gov) transactions, the Vitu platform is reimagining how drivers, businesses and governments interact with vehicles.
